Robert Bennet Obituary

Robert A. Bennett, Jr., 72, passed away Tuesday peacefully at home. He leaves his wife of 27 years, Alice Jean (Williamson) Bennett. His first wife, Jennie (Denio) Bennett died in 1979. He also leaves his sons, Robert J. Bennett and his wife Marge of Webster, Richard A. Bennett and his wife Janet of Oxford, Kenneth J. Carson and his wife Mary of Framingham; two daughters, Pebbles J. Carson and her fiancé Bernie Baldwin of Holland, Susan M. Ricard and her fiancé David Gardner of Webster; his brother, Phillip Bennett and his wife Elizabeth of Oxford; 16 grandchildren, 4 great grandchildren; nieces and nephews. A son, Craig Carson died in 1997.

He was born in Oxford the son of Robert A. and Frances (Nebozny) Bennett and has lived in Webster since 1987. Robert worked for 30 years for area fuel distributors retiring in 1989. He was a member of the Carnival Glass Collectors and served as a board member. Robert enjoyed his family, woodworking and antiquing.
